  • East-West Center's new inaugural Presidential Chair Jean Lee discusses the latest on the uncertainty around South Korean politics | Full Story
  • Hye-ryeon Lee, who is the chair of the School of Communication and Information at UH Mānoa and studies health communication, talks about vaccine hesitancy | Full Story
  • HPR's Catherine Cluett Pactol reports on a grant that will go towards housing and infrastructure for Maui fire survivors
  • Longtime educator and author Barbara Hilyer talks about her new children’s book that examines the life of Helene Hale, a fixture in Hawaiʻi politics for half a century | Full Story
